免费语音SDK的语音识别是否支持语音识别与语音识别评估?
随着人工智能技术的不断发展,语音识别技术已经广泛应用于各个领域。免费语音SDK作为一种便捷的语音识别工具,受到了众多开发者的青睐。然而,很多开发者在使用免费语音SDK时,都会产生这样的疑问:免费语音SDK的语音识别是否支持语音识别与语音识别评估?本文将对此问题进行详细解答。
一、免费语音SDK的语音识别功能
免费语音SDK是指提供语音识别、语音合成、语音转写等功能的软件开发工具包。这类工具包通常由一些知名的技术公司提供,如科大讯飞、百度语音等。免费语音SDK的语音识别功能主要包括以下几个方面:
语音识别:将语音信号转换为文本信息,实现人机交互。
语音合成:将文本信息转换为语音信号,实现语音播报。
语音转写:将语音信号转换为文字,方便用户查看和记录。
语音识别评估:对语音识别结果进行评估,包括准确率、召回率、F1值等指标。
二、免费语音SDK的语音识别评估
免费语音SDK的语音识别评估功能是指对语音识别结果进行量化分析,以评估语音识别系统的性能。以下是免费语音SDK语音识别评估的主要指标:
准确率:指正确识别的语音字数与总语音字数的比值。准确率越高,说明语音识别系统的性能越好。
召回率:指正确识别的语音字数与实际语音字数的比值。召回率越高,说明语音识别系统对语音内容的覆盖范围越广。
F1值:准确率和召回率的调和平均值,综合考虑了准确率和召回率。F1值越高,说明语音识别系统的性能越好。
时延:指从接收到语音信号到输出识别结果的时间。时延越短,说明语音识别系统的响应速度越快。
三、免费语音SDK语音识别评估的适用场景
语音助手:如智能音箱、车载语音助手等,需要对语音识别结果进行实时评估,以提高用户体验。
语音翻译:如在线翻译、离线翻译等,需要对语音识别结果进行评估,以确保翻译的准确性。
语音搜索:如语音搜索、语音助手等,需要对语音识别结果进行评估,以提高搜索的准确性。
语音识别系统优化:如开发者对语音识别系统进行优化,需要对语音识别结果进行评估,以验证优化效果。
四、免费语音SDK语音识别评估的实现方法
使用免费语音SDK提供的评估工具:部分免费语音SDK提供了评估工具,如科大讯飞语音评测工具、百度语音评测工具等。开发者可以通过这些工具对语音识别结果进行评估。
自定义评估方法:开发者可以根据实际需求,自定义评估方法。例如,使用混淆矩阵、ROC曲线等指标对语音识别结果进行评估。
使用第三方评估工具:市场上存在一些第三方评估工具,如Kaldi、ESPnet等。开发者可以使用这些工具对语音识别结果进行评估。
五、总结
免费语音SDK的语音识别功能强大,不仅支持语音识别,还支持语音识别评估。通过对语音识别结果进行评估,开发者可以了解语音识别系统的性能,并对其进行优化。因此,免费语音SDK在语音识别领域具有广泛的应用前景。
猜你喜欢:一站式出海解决方案